Other ways of improving your boiler efficiency are by installing Waste Heat recovery boilers/devices. Heat from the flue gases leaving the boiler can be recovered using equipment such as Economisers , Air pre-heaters, superheaters or using this waste heat in your process.

Live ChatThe feedwater consists of the condensate return water and treated makeup water. Feedwater heaters extract the waste heat from the spent steam to preheat the boiler feedwater. Preheating the boiler feedwater increases the boiler efficiency by decreasing the energy required to heat the water to steam.

Live ChatWaste Exhaust Heat Boilers. Approximately 25% of the usable energy of the fuel gas is released in the exhaust of the gas engine. This can be captured for cogeneration in a combined heat and power plant. This heat exits the engine at ~450 o C as ‘high grade heat’, contrasting to ‘low-grade heat’ available from the generator cooling circuits. This high temperature and flow makes it well suited for utilisation in a waste heat boiler.

Live ChatJan 01, 2017 · This paper presents briefly on the boiler efficiency evaluation procedures by direct and indirect methods useful in thermal power plants. In the direct method consideration is given to the amount of heat utilized while evaluating the efficiency of the boiler, whereas, indirect method accounts for various heat losses.

Live ChatA common application of economizers in steam power plants is to capture the waste heat from boiler stack gases (flue gas) and transfer it to the boiler feedwater. This raises the temperature of the boiler feedwater, lowering the needed energy input, in turn reducing the firing rates needed for the rated boiler output.

Live ChatJan 01, 2013 · Economizers for boilers. An economizer recovers waste heat from fluegases by heating BFW, and hence reduces boiler fuel requirements. Flue-gases are often rejected to the stack at 30 to 70°C higher than the temperature of the generated steam. Generally, boiler efficiency can be increased by ~ 1% for every 22°C reduction in fluegas temperature.

Live ChatA heat recovery steam generator (HRSG) is an energy recovery heat exchanger that recovers heat from a hot gas stream. It produces steam that can be used in a process (cogeneration) or used to drive a steam turbine (combined cycle). The term HRSG refers to the waste heat boiler in a Combined Cycle Power Plant.
Live ChatA boiler or Steam Generator (prime mover) is an integral device in a fossil fuel power plant used to produce steam by applying heat energy to water. A boiler incorporates a furnace in order to burn the fossil fuel (coal, gas, waste etc.) and generate heat which is transferred to water to make steam.

Live ChatThe waste heat from a gas turbine, in the form of hot exhaust gas, can be used to raise steam, by passing this gas through a heat recovery steam generator (HRSG) the steam is then used to drive a steam turbine in a combined cycle plant that improves overall efficiency.
